KLE Society’s Institute of Dental Science is commonly known as KLE Dental College Bangalore (KLEDC). The college was started in the year 1992 – 1993. It is one of the private dental institutions in India. Their main motto is to provide good dental health and oral and maxillofacial surgery.

This college is a reputed private institute. The College is affiliated with Rajiv Gandhi University of Health Science, Bangalore, and approved by the Dental Council of India.

The courses offered by the college are BDS and MDS. Hostel facilities are available. The category of college comes under Dental Colleges in Bangalore.

The college provides both BDS and MDS courses. The Bachelor in Dental Surgery (BDS) is a five-year course including a one-year rotary internship. Master of Dental Surgery (MDS) is a three-year course.

MDS Available in KLE Dental College Bangalore

COURSE OFFERED BY THE COLLEGE DEPARTMENTS NO. OF SEATS
MDS ORTHODONTICS 5
MDS PEDODONTICS 2
MDS PERIODONTICS 2
MDS ORAL MEDICINE AND RADIOLOGY 2
MDS ORAL AND MAXILLOFACIAL SURGERY 3
MDS PROSTHODONTICS 5
MDS CONSERVATIVE DENTISTRY AND ENDODONTICS 2
MDS PUBLIC HEALTH DENTISTRY 3
BDS N/A 50

KLE Dental College Bangalore Fees Structure

BDS Fees

Govt Quota Private Quota NRI Quota
INR 95,808/- INR 4,12,700/- INR 4,12,700/-


MDS Fees

Specialization Fees (N/Q Quota)
Oral Surgery Rs. 11,15,750/-
Orthodontics Rs. 14,15,750/-
Conservative Dentistry Rs. 14,15,750/-
Oral Pathology Rs. 11,15,750/-

Department of Oral Medicine and Radiology

Oral medicine and radiology is a branch of dentistry that deals with diagnosing and treating patients with diseases in the paraoral and oral structures. The departments are equipped with the latest technical equipment and thus giving it the status of one of the Top-ranked BDS Colleges in Bangalore.

They have a qualified faculty or specialist who can treat patients with medical conditions that will affect the dental treatment, such as carcinoma, certain infectious diseases, diabetic Mellitus, cardiovascular issues, etc.

They have a well-equipped Oral Radiology department to examine the jaw, teeth, oral structures, para-oral structures, head, and neck regions. The images are taken to interpret and diagnose the diseases which affect all the structures mentioned above, such as the jaw, teeth, etc.

The central vision and objective of the department are to diagnose clinically and radiographically, to do treatment planning, and radiographical manage the diseases.

The department is mainly exposed to cases such as odontogenic diseases, nonodontogenic diseases, temporomandibular disorders, cysts and tumors, salivary gland disorders, conditions, and fractures of orofacial pain.

The Department of Oral Medicine and Radiology in KLE Society’s Dental College is on the front line to diagnose precancerous and cancer conditions.

The department has started a Ph.D. program in Oral Medicine and Radiology.

There are many research programs conducted by the college, such as evaluating the external structure or the morphology of the soft palate.

  1. Patterns of the infraorbital canals.
  2. Study of remineralization of the enamel through CPP ACP.
  3. Association of the oral mucosal lesion with Hb1A1c level in a patient with Diabetic Mellitus.
  4. TNM staging of Oral Cancer
  5. Detection of HPV in oral leukoplakia
  6. Detection of incidences and patterns of calcification of the styloid process
  7. Radiation safety measures.

The ongoing research projects include:

  1. Salivary Biomarkers in Tobacco Induced mucosal lesions.
  2. Effects of tube current on CBCT (Cone Beam Computed Tomography)
  3. Observation of oral premalignant and malignant lesions
  4. ONCOGRID it’s a mobile health approach for the prevention and diagnosis of oral cancer in rural areas.

Department of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ery

Department of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ery mainly deals with treating diseases, injuries, deformities, and management involving the mouth, teeth, gums, and jaw.

KLE Society’s Dental College also has a post-graduation course in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ery. It’s a three-year course.

They have tie-up with various National Organizations and highly qualified staff in India.

Its main Vision and Motto is to provide excellent teaching facilities for undergraduate and postgraduate students. To provide high-quality care for the patient with output.

To facilitate researches

Also, training the undergraduate in the field and surgery and the postgraduate students provide additional knowledge and ability to pursue oral and maxillofacial surgery.

The oral and maxillofacial surgery department provides different treatments such as minor surgeries, impaction, pathology, trauma, temporomandibular disorders, cleft lip and palate, dental implant, and facial aesthetic surgeries.

Department of Conservative Dentistry and Endodontics

Department of Conservative Dentistry and Endodontics mainly deals with the prevention of caries, and restoration of the diseased tooth; this can be done either by restoration, root canal treatment, aesthetic dentistry, etc.

They also have microsurgery, RVG, bleaching unit, dental laboratory, well-equipped dental chair, and surgical operating microscope.

Sterilization and cross-contamination are essential in the field of dentistry; they follow proper protocol. The postgraduate degree provides advanced education such as clinical and research components. Their main vision is to provide dental health care services to the people and provide the best dental skills and knowledge to the students.

The various treatment done by the Department of Conservative Dentistry and Endodontics include

Root canal treatment, endodontic treatment, aesthetic treatment, retreatments such as Root canal treatment, regenerative Endodontics, and endodontic microsurgery. Aesthetic and traumatic dental injuries.

Postgraduate students learned to do many special cases such as microscopic Endodontics, vital tooth bleaching, ceramic veneer, internal resorption management, and revascularization.

There are around 23 national and 13 international publications done by the college.

The research done is in Microscopic Dentistry, Nanotechnology, Advanced Endodontics, Dental caries, Regenerative Dentistry, Adhesive dentistry, etc.

Department of Periodontics

The Department of Periodontics mainly deals with the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of the diseases surrounding and supporting the teeth and the structures.
There is a wide range of treatments done in different cases. The latest technology used in periodontal regenerative technology to maintain the health, and the aesthetic of the periodontal structure.

Their main motto is to provide the latest advances in dentistry. Provide strong education to the students in Periodontology.

They also conduct various programs such as oral health, screening, and oral hygiene day program; some treatments are done free on behalf of this program, such as scaling.

They also conduct CDE programs, workshops, certified training courses, conferences, etc.

What is the treatment provided by the college?

The treatment provided by the college include scaling and root planing, management of mobile teeth, management of sensitive teeth, dental implant treatment, electrosurgery, treatment of gums, local drug delivery, management of pigmented gums, laser therapy, regenerative periodontal therapy, grafting therapy for esthetic, etc.

The department’s various special cases include root coverage procedures, smile make-over procedures, laser gingival depigmentation, laser treatment for excision of mucocele, ridge augmentation and placement of an implant, and management of end period lesions.

Researchers are mainly done in the field of dental implants, photodynamic therapy, HMT ( host modulation therapy), laser-assisted periodontal flap surgery, and platelet concentration in periodontal regeneration treatment.

Department of Pedodontics and Preventive Dentistry

Department of Pedodontics and Preventive Dentistry mainly deals with the dental health of children. It primarily deals with the dentition of children—the dental health and treatment of children, infants, and adolescents.

The department posting starts from the third year for undergraduates. Post-graduation in Pedodontics is also present.

Interns are also posted in the department and work with the supervision of staff and undertake the work.

Most of the time dental health of the children is neglected. So KLE Society’s Dental college used to conduct many dental health checkup camps free of cost to make them aware of dental health, and also certain simple restorations are done from the camp itself. Those cases that need root canal treatments are referred to the college.

Department also does much research such as the Oral Health Coalition, and Prenatal Network of Maternal and Oral Health Professionals. The prevalence of Early Childhood Caries in Preschool Children. The effect of the various appliance on swallowing pattern, Prenatal, and Post Natal oral Health Literacy status.

Orthodontics and Dentofacial Orthopedics in KLE Dental College Bangalore

Orthodontics and Dentofacial Orthopedics is a branch of dentistry that deals with the correction of the disproportion of the jaw and teeth in children and adults to improve their smile, aesthetics, and function.

The department of Orthodontics and Dentofacial Orthopedics in KLE Society’s Dental college is headed by Dr. Sumithra, a Diploma of Indian Board Orthodontics.
The undergraduates are posted from the third year in the department, and the postgraduate seats are also there. They have separate undergraduate and postgraduate seminar halls and labs.

Talking about the research program. The department has around completed 40 research programs and 10 ongoing research programs. The research program mainly deals with minis crews, implants, bonding material, model analysis, etc.

The students at the conference also do many paper presentations.

At the national and international levels, there are around 80 publications.

Department of Prosthodontics Crown and Bridge

Department of Prosthodontics Crown and Bridge is a branch of dentistry that deals with replacing missing teeth and surrounding structures with artificial dentures.
Apart from this, there are removable partial dentures, complete dentures, Implant placement, and preparation of Crown and Bridge.

They also conduct many denture-free camps. In such camps, dentures are made and delivered in a short period of time.

Apart from this, other departments include the Department of Pathology and Microbiology, Department of Public Health Dentistry, department of Maxillofacial Pathology, Department of Pharmacology, Department of Physiology, Department of Anatomy, and Department of Health Dental Implantology.
